Output 21ffa8f75af490de315a78ba692832efa7197f6dc7895dbe6fbb688f82f5b99a:0

value
126619748
script pubkey
OP_0 OP_PUSHBYTES_20 861bb2d0cd69c872d24ea6be0fb9045cb9c38bbc
address
bc1qscdm95xdd8y895jw56lqlwgytjuu8zau76afkk
transaction
21ffa8f75af490de315a78ba692832efa7197f6dc7895dbe6fbb688f82f5b99a
spent
true